Lane Avenue Park, nestled at the end of Lane Ave in Phoenixville, PA, is a quiet and dog-friendly neighborhood park perfect for local residents. With a spacious open field, this hidden gem welcomes both kids and dogs to enjoy some fresh air and exercise. The park’s serene atmosphere and scarcity of crowds make it ideal for pet owners looking for a peaceful outdoor space. Although it’s a smaller park, its accessibility and proximity to local homes make it convenient for frequent visits.
In addition to being pet-friendly, Lane Avenue Park features a well-equipped playground with slides, a climbing area, and swings—making it a great destination for families with children. While there isn’t a designated fenced dog park area, the expansive field provides ample room for dogs to run and play. Parking is limited, so it’s best suited for those within walking distance. Lane Avenue Park stands out for its relaxed, community vibe and its accessibility, including a wheelchair-accessible entrance. This is a small, quiet, neighborhood park. It has a large field for kids or dogs to run around in, a small playset with three slides, a climbing area, and two swings but no toddler swings.
There’s only parking for 3 cars and this isn’t really a park you go out of your way for but it’s great if you can walk to it. It’s tucked away at the end of Lane Ave so you don’t really need to worry about cars with the small exception of the people who live along the road.
There’s hardly anyone there but it does seem to get a lot of mosquitoes in the summer.
All in all it’s a nice park to take your kids to if you live within walking distance and want to avoid crowds.
